Output 7c15a46aeecaf06e12955924ac1658305d2c34ca54187ae8943d0ba597772393: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d17c8ea815a0967af21042746020afbf7740b591 OP_EQUAL
address
3LngN2TT59NrHWU5FT4Sr7Wkq51QPDmhF2
transaction
7c15a46aeecaf06e12955924ac1658305d2c34ca54187ae8943d0ba597772393
spent
true